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Cajun Beef Spaghetti

Step 1: Cook the Spaghetti
In a large pot, bring salted water to a rolling boil over high heat. Add the spaghetti and cook according to package instructions until al dente, typically around 8-10 minutes. Drain the pasta, reserving a cup of the cooking water in case you need to thin the sauce later. Toss the drained spaghetti gently with a drizzle of olive oil to prevent sticking while you prepare the sauce.

Step 2: Sear the Beef
Heat a large skillet over medium-high heat and add a tablespoon of butter. Once melted, toss in the diced sirloin or ribeye steak seasoned with Cajun seasoning. Sear the beef for about 4-5 minutes, stirring occasionally, until browned and slightly crispy on the edges. Ensure it remains juicy and tender, then remove the beef from the skillet and set it aside on a plate while you make the sauce.

Step 3: Sauté the Garlic
In the same skillet, add another tablespoon of butter if needed, and reduce the heat to medium. Add the minced garlic and sauté for about 1 minute, stirring constantly to prevent burning. As the garlic becomes fragrant and golden, the skillet’s base will accumulate flavorful bits—this is where your Cajun Beef Spaghetti will take on depth and character.

Step 4: Create the Creamy Sauce
Pour in the heavy cream, followed by cream cheese, mozzarella, and Parmesan cheese into the skillet. Stir the mixture continuously over medium heat until all the cheeses melt and blend into a smooth, velvety sauce—this should take about 3-5 minutes. You want the sauce to be bubbling gently, ensuring it’s well mixed and ready to envelop the pasta with its creamy goodness.

Step 5: Combine Everything Together
Return the cooked spaghetti and seared beef back into the skillet, tossing everything together gently. Use tongs to ensure each strand of pasta is thoroughly coated in the creamy three-cheese sauce. If the sauce is too thick, you can add a splash of the reserved pasta water to achieve your desired consistency, ensuring that all components of your Cajun Beef Spaghetti are perfectly integrated.

Step 6: Serve and Garnish
Once well combined, remove the skillet from heat and transfer the Cajun Beef Spaghetti into serving bowls. Garnish generously with chopped fresh parsley and, if desired, an extra sprinkle of Parmesan cheese or an additional dash of Cajun seasoning for an extra kick. Serve immediately while hot, and prepare to enjoy a delightful blend of flavors in every bite!

Expert Tips for Cajun Beef Spaghetti

  • Fresh Cheese Matters: Using freshly grated cheese enhances melting and flavor, transforming your Cajun Beef Spaghetti into a creamy delight.

  • Don’t Overcook the Beef: Keep a close eye on your beef while it sears. Overcooking can make it tough; aim for tender, juicy pieces to elevate your dish.

  • Adjust the Spice: If you’re sensitive to heat, start with half the recommended Cajun seasoning and adjust gradually to find your perfect balance of flavor.

  • Thin the Sauce: If the sauce is too thick when combining, add a splash of reserved pasta water for the perfect creamy consistency.

  • Reheating Tips: When reheating leftovers, stir in a bit of heavy cream or milk to restore the creamy texture of your Cajun Beef Spaghetti.

  • Add Veggies: For extra color and nutrition, consider tossing in some sautéed bell peppers or zucchini when combining the spaghetti and sauce.

How to Store and Freeze Cajun Beef Spaghetti

Fridge: Store leftover Cajun Beef Spaghetti in an airtight container for up to 3 days. Make sure it cools completely before sealing to maintain freshness.

Freezer: For longer storage, freeze the spaghetti in a freezer-safe container for up to 3 months. To prevent freezer burn, wrap tightly in plastic wrap before placing in a container.

Reheating: When ready to enjoy, thaw overnight in the fridge, then gently reheat on the stove over low heat. Add a splash of cream or milk to restore the creamy texture for the best results.

Leftover Tips: Always check for freshness before consuming leftovers, and if the sauce is thickened after freezing, don’t hesitate to add a bit of cream while reheating.

Ingredients
  

For the Pasta
  • 8 oz Spaghetti or fettuccine, penne, or rigatoni
For the Beef
  • 1 lb Diced Sirloin or Ribeye Steak Ground beef can be used as a budget-friendly alternative
For the Cajun Flavor
  • 2 tbsp Cajun Seasoning Adjust to taste
For the Sauce
  • 2 tbsp Butter plus more if needed
  • 3 cloves Garlic freshly minced
  • 1 cup Heavy Cream
  • 4 oz Cream Cheese ricotta is a substitute
  • 1 cup Mozzarella Cheese or provolone, Monterey Jack
  • 1/2 cup Parmesan Cheese or Pecorino Romano
For Seasoning
  • to taste Salt and Black Pepper
  • 1/4 cup Chopped Fresh Parsley for garnishing

Equipment

  • large pot
  • Skillet
  • Tongs

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ions for Cajun Beef Spaghetti
  1. In a large pot, bring salted water to a rolling boil and cook spaghetti according to package instructions until al dente, about 8-10 minutes. Drain and set aside.
  2. Heat a large skillet over medium-high heat and add butter. Sear diced sirloin or ribeye steak seasoned with Cajun seasoning for about 4-5 minutes until browned.
  3. In the same skillet, add butter and sauté minced garlic for about 1 minute until fragrant.
  4. Pour in heavy cream, then add cream cheese, mozzarella, and Parmesan cheese. Stir until melted and smooth, about 3-5 minutes.
  5. Return cooked spaghetti and seared beef to skillet, tossing everything together gently. Add reserved pasta water as needed to loosen the sauce.
  6. Remove from heat, serve in bowls, and garnish with chopped parsley and additional Parmesan or Cajun seasoning if desired.
